A2 Cities Discussion Questions for Young Learners (7-9)

Seven- to nine-year-olds experience their town or city as a series of landmarks and favourite spots: the ice cream shop, the tall building, the park with the good swings, the funny statue. These 50 questions invite young learners to share that mental map in English: 'What is your favourite shop?' 'Is there a big building near your home?' 'What do you see on the way to school?' Each question taps into spatial knowledge that even very young children possess.

The vocabulary names the features of any town or city that young children notice: 'bridge,' 'tower,' 'fountain,' 'market,' 'statue,' and 'pavement.' These are concrete, visual words that children can point to and remember because they connect to places they know and visit.

Sharing mental maps in English

Cities discussions with 7-9 year olds work best as 'I spy' style conversations. 'What is the tallest thing near your school?' invites the child to visualise their environment and name what they see. This visual-spatial recall produces natural, enthusiastic A2 English grounded in personal experience.

Place words children can point to

For young learner classes, cities questions make excellent paired drawing activities. Each child describes a place while their partner draws it. The communication purpose is real and immediate: if the listener draws a bridge when the speaker said a tower, the vocabulary gap becomes visible and correctable in the moment.
